Dorothy Long, age 73, of Moag Rd. passed away Friday, August 8th, 2014 at the LeRoy Village Green. She was born in Warsaw, March 3rd, 1941, daughter of the late Alfred E. and Elsie M. Falkner Moag. A lifetime resident of Wyoming County, Dorothy worked as a payroll manager for B. R. Dewitt in Pavilion from where she retired in 2002. She was chaplain of the International Skamper Campers Club and member of the Go-fer Campers chapter of the International Skamper Campers Club, lifetime member of the Covington United Methodist Church where she was church organist since 1975, former church trustee and nominations committee.
